重庆农村地区雷电灾害时间分布规律及重灾年份预测

摘要: 重庆农村地区雷电灾害严重,每年都会造成较大的人员伤亡和财产损失。通过分析1998—2012年雷电灾害时间分布规律,运用灰色系统理论建模方法,建立了雷电灾害重灾年份灰色灾变GM(1,1)预测模型,对全市农村地区雷电灾害趋势进行了预测。预测结果表明,未来20年将出现4~5个重灾年份,特别是2021年将是雷灾损失非常严重的年份,为政府部门制订防雷减灾规划和对策提供了科学依据,将有助于减轻雷灾的威胁和危害。

Abstract: Lightning disasters were serious in rural areas in Chongqing, which made greater casualties and property loss every year. By analyzing the time distribution rule of lightning disasters from 1998 to 2012 and using the grey system theory modeling method, the grey cataclysm GM (1,1) prediction model of disastrous year was established to predict the lightning disaster trend in rural areas in Chongqing. The prediction result showed that: in the future 20 years, especially the year of 2021, it would be 4 to 5 disastrous years. The researches offered the scientific basis to the government sectors to make out the lightning protection and disaster mitigation plans and countermeasures, and contribute to reduce the threat and harm of lightning disasters.
